Looking for Majors Info at UAlbany

Hey! I'm a junior planning to apply to UAlbany in the near future. Does anyone here have experience with or knowledge about the majors they offer there? Any advice that might help guide my exploration of their programs? Cheers!

Certainly, I'd be happy to help share some general insights! The University at Albany, part of the SUNY system, offers over 50 undergraduate majors in a wide range of fields. These fields broadly include the Liberal Arts, Sciences, Business, Criminal Justice, Public Health, and more.

If you're interested in Business disciplines, UAlbany's School of Business has AACSB accreditation, which is a highly respected accreditation. They offer concentrations in areas like Finance, Management, and Marketing.

For students interested in the Sciences, the university boasts in-depth programs in areas like Biology, Chemistry, Environmental and Sustainability Sciences, and more. These programs often provide ample research opportunities which can be beneficial if you're considering graduate school in the future.

UAlbany also has a strong emphasis on Public Affairs and Policy studies. In fact, their Rockefeller College of Public Affairs & Policy is regarded as one of the top Public Affairs schools in the nation.

A unique offering at UAlbany is their School of Criminal Justice, which has been ranked very highly nationwide and could be an excellent choice if you're considering a career related to criminal justice or law enforcement.

As for navigating their major offerings, I would recommend browsing through the list of undergraduate majors on the UAlbany website, taking note of ones that align with your interests and future career goals. Read the course descriptions and maybe look for faculty research areas that could complement your academic interests.

Remember, you typically don't need to declare your major immediately when you apply as a first-year student, so there is time to explore different interests once you're at UAlbany. Based on the university's offerings and breadth, there should be plenty of opportunities for you to find a course of study that fits your interests.
